Страница 1 из 2

Не ставится SAMBA

Добавлено: 2008-07-18 9:24:49
gonzo111
Второй день пытаюсь поставить самбу лезет такая вот бодяга :shock: :shock:

Код: Выделить всё

===>   samba-3.0.30,1 depends on file: /usr/local/bin/autoconf-2.61 - found
===>   samba-3.0.30,1 depends on shared library: execinfo.1 - not found
===>    Verifying install for execinfo.1 in /usr/ports/devel/libexecinfo
=> libexecinfo-1.1.tar.bz2 doesn't seem to exist in /usr/ports/distfiles/.
=> Attempting to fetch from 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/.
fetch: 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/libexecinfo-1.1.tar.bz2: Permission denied
=> Attempting to fetch from ftp://ftp.se.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/.
fetch: ftp://ftp.se.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/libexecinfo-1.1.tar.bz2: Permission denied
=> Attempting to fetch from ftp://ftp.uk.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/.
fetch: ftp://ftp.uk.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/libexecinfo-1.1.tar.bz2: Permission denied
=> Attempting to fetch from ftp://ftp.ru.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/.
fetch: ftp://ftp.ru.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/libexecinfo-1.1.tar.bz2: Permission denied
=> Attempting to fetch from ftp://ftp.jp.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/.
fetch: ftp://ftp.jp.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/libexecinfo-1.1.tar.bz2: Permission denied
=> Attempting to fetch from ftp://ftp.tw.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/.
fetch: ftp://ftp.tw.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/libexecinfo-1.1.tar.bz2: Permission denied
=> Attempting to fetch from ftp://ftp.cn.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/.
fetch: ftp://ftp.cn.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/itetcu/libexecinfo-1.1.tar.bz2: Permission denied
=> Attempting to fetch from 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/distfiles/.
fetch: 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/distfiles/libexecinfo-1.1.tar.bz2: Permission denied
=> Couldn't fetch it - please try to retrieve this
=> port manually into /usr/ports/distfiles/ and try again.
*** Error code 1

Stop in /usr/ports/devel/libexecinfo.
*** Error code 1

Stop in /usr/ports/net/samba3.
*** Error code 1

Stop in /usr/ports/net/samba3.
в чем прикол?
что делать, ждать когда допилят? может руками скачать libexecinfo-1.1.tar.bz2 ?
вообще весело, я то старую версию успел уже удалить :sorry: сервак щас сидит без самбы :pardon:

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:28:40
zingel
разрешить тому пользователю от которого ставите пользовать этот файл....(fetch)

Код: Выделить всё

chown && chmod

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:29:32
gonzo111
от рута ставлю! :cf: fetch SAMBA 12мб же сделало

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:32:28
zingel
тогда поправьте файрвол и откройте доступ к сайту фряхи, у меня без проблем этот пакет загрузился, значит проблема на Вашей стороне.

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:35:56
gonzo111
дак остальные порты ставит и качает в фаере все открыто, еще раз обновил дерево портов думал поможет :Search:

Код: Выделить всё

df -h
Filesystem     Size    Used   Avail Capacity  Mounted on
/dev/ad4s1a    1.9G     52M    1.7G     3%    /
devfs          1.0K    1.0K      0B   100%    /dev
/dev/ad4s1g    185G     30G    140G    17%    /arc
/dev/ad4s1f    4.8G     94M    4.4G     2%    /tmp
/dev/ad4s1e     19G    1.9G     16G    11%    /usr
/dev/ad4s1d    9.7G    1.2G    7.7G    14%    /var
devfs          1.0K    1.0K      0B   100%    /var/named/dev
места свободного вроде как хватает :Search:

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:39:01
zingel
значит Вас забанили.... :(

аттачь

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:45:53
gonzo111
дак если бы меня забаннили то и дерево портов по идее не должно обновлятся

может samba4wins поставить? это что за зверь? что то для него даже опций сборки нема
make

Код: Выделить всё

=> samba4wins_1.0.6-1.tar.gz doesn't seem to exist in /usr/ports/distfiles/.
=> Attempting to fetch from http://ftp.sernet.de/pub/samba4WINS/debian/pool/.
samba4wins_1.0.6-1.tar.gz                       8% of 7062 kB  102 kBps^C
fetch: transfer interrupted
спасибо конечно но как то стремно чужое на серваке юзать

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:49:49
zingel
на апстриме 21 порт открыт? + дайте вывод

Код: Выделить всё

ldd /usr/bin/fetch

Код: Выделить всё

which fetch | xargs ls -lad

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:54:02
gonzo111
в смысле входящий трафик?
закрыт конешно :-D
а что что надо открыть? для чего?

Re: Не ставится SAMBA

Добавлено: 2008-07-18 9:58:20
zingel
если на апстриме закрыт 21 порт: как Вы собирались качать, что либо? Коннект рвётся, это видно, вот почему, это надо смотреть с Вашей стороны

Re: Не ставится SAMBA

Добавлено: 2008-07-18 10:01:17
gonzo111

Код: Выделить всё

ldd /usr/bin/fetch
/usr/bin/fetch:
        libfetch.so.4 => /usr/lib/libfetch.so.4 (0x28077000)
        libssl.so.4 => /usr/lib/libssl.so.4 (0x28083000)
        libcrypto.so.4 => /lib/libcrypto.so.4 (0x280b1000)
        libc.so.6 => /lib/libc.so.6 (0x281a3000)

Код: Выделить всё

/>which fetch | xargs ls -lad
-r-xr-xr-x  1 root  wheel  17192  3 ноя  2005 /usr/bin/fetch

что значит на апстриме?

Re: Не ставится SAMBA

Добавлено: 2008-07-18 10:05:33
zingel
через того, кто Вам поставляет услуги связи.....вобщем - качайте руками, проблемы в Вашей сети или в кривом fetch

Re: Не ставится SAMBA

Добавлено: 2008-07-18 10:23:30
gonzo111
СПАСИБО

ну я тормоз сам же 21 порт закрыл нафиг недавно
остальные порты по http же качало и ставило :-D :ROFL: :ROFL:

Re: Не ставится SAMBA

Добавлено: 2008-07-18 10:32:55
gonzo111
:smile:

Re: Не ставится SAMBA

Добавлено: 2008-07-18 10:48:41
gonzo111

Код: Выделить всё

===>  Installing for libgcrypt-1.4.1_1
===>   libgcrypt-1.4.1_1 depends on file: /usr/local/libdata/ldconfig - found
===>   Generating temporary packing list
===>  Checking if security/libgcrypt already installed
===>   An older version of security/libgcrypt is already installed (libgcrypt-1.2.1_1)
      You may wish to ``make deinstall'' and install this port again
      by ``make reinstall'' to upgrade it properly.
      If you really wish to overwrite the old port of security/libgcrypt
      without deleting it first, set the variable "FORCE_PKG_REGISTER"
      in your environment or the "make install" command line.
*** Error code 1

Stop in /usr/ports/security/libgcrypt.
*** Error code 1

Stop in /usr/ports/security/gnutls.
*** Error code 1

Stop in /usr/ports/print/cups-base.
*** Error code 1

Stop in /usr/ports/net/samba3.
*** Error code 1

Stop in /usr/ports/net/samba3.
а как по научному ставить так чтоб оно само зависимости обновляло?

Re: Не ставится SAMBA

Добавлено: 2008-07-18 10:50:09
zingel

Код: Выделить всё

portupgrade -aRrk
и не ставить то, что уже стоит.

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:00:24
gonzo111
дак мне ставить надо а не апгрейдить разве поможет?
ключики -ak я лучше пропущу
а как название узнать? оно совпадает с названием каталога порта?

Код: Выделить всё

>portupgrade -Rr samba
** No such installed package: samba
 /usr/ports/net/samba3/>portupgrade -Rr samba3
** No such installed package: samba3
я понимаю что можно найти libgcrypt-1.2.1_1 и написать make uninstall && make reinstall
но это как то неправильно по всем зависимостям бегать

кстати, а де лиссяра..на морях наверно :smile:

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:12:25
manefesto

Код: Выделить всё

portupgrade -afR

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:13:13
Alex Keda
да я не вкурю о чём вы тут.

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:15:04
gonzo111
да какой upgrade если он make deinstall

Код: Выделить всё

===>   An older version of security/gnutls is already installed (gnutls-1.0.24_1)
      You may wish to ``make deinstall'' and install this port again
      by ``make reinstall'' to upgrade it properly.
      If you really wish to overwrite the old port of security/gnutls
      without deleting it first, set the variable "FORCE_PKG_REGISTER"
      in your environment or the "make install" command line.
*** Error code 1
снова :cry:

кто подскажет как поставить порт так чтобы зависимости сами обновились?

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:16:15
Alex Keda
manefesto писал(а):

Код: Выделить всё

portupgrade -afR

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:21:25
gonzo111

Код: Выделить всё

 /usr/ports/net/samba3root/>portupgrade -aR
[missing key: categories] [Updating the portsdb <format:bdb_btree> in /usr/ports ... - 18778 port entries found .........1000.........2000.........3000.........4000.........5000.........6000.........7000.........8000.........9000.........10000.........11000.........12000.........13000.........14000.........15000.........16000.........17000.........18000....... ..... done]
missing key: categories: Cannot read the portsdb!
/usr/local/lib/ruby/site_ruby/1.8/portsdb.rb:567:in `open_db': database file error (PortsDB::DBError)
        from /usr/local/lib/ruby/site_ruby/1.8/portsdb.rb:736:in `port'
        from /usr/local/lib/ruby/site_ruby/1.8/portsdb.rb:924:in `all_depends_list'
        from /usr/local/lib/ruby/site_ruby/1.8/pkgdb.rb:915:in `tsort_build'
        from /usr/local/lib/ruby/site_ruby/1.8/pkgdb.rb:907:in `each'
        from /usr/local/lib/ruby/site_ruby/1.8/pkgdb.rb:907:in `tsort_build'
        from /usr/local/lib/ruby/site_ruby/1.8/pkgdb.rb:929:in `sort_build'
        from /usr/local/lib/ruby/site_ruby/1.8/pkgdb.rb:933:in `sort_build!'
        from /usr/local/sbin/portupgrade:694:in `main'
        from /usr/local/lib/ruby/1.8/optparse.rb:755:in `initialize'
        from /usr/local/sbin/portupgrade:210:in `new'
        from /usr/local/sbin/portupgrade:210:in `main'
        from /usr/local/sbin/portupgrade:1981
:cry:
снова трабла как базу портов portupgrade подлечить?
а если мне надо конкретно самбу ставить и я не хочу обновлять все остальное это что "no" надо будет каждый раз писать на всем остальном??

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:28:18
zingel

Код: Выделить всё

portupgrade -f japanese/samba

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:39:39
gonzo111
а чего japanese :ROFL: :ROFL: а не /net/samba3

Код: Выделить всё

>portupgrade -f japanese/samba
** No such installed package: japanese/samba
:(

Re: Не ставится SAMBA

Добавлено: 2008-07-18 11:44:37
zingel
а чего japanese :ROFL: :ROFL: а не /net/samba3

Код: Выделить всё

man locate

Код: Выделить всё

man portupgrade

Код: Выделить всё

man make

Код: Выделить всё

man portsdb